Comments

Known from the Río San Juan system (Ref. 81264). Type locality, interior basin of Llanos de Salas, Aramberri, Nuevo Leon, Charco de Palma, UANL 8281(holotype of Cyprinodon longidorsalis, 4.06 cm SL, mature male) (Ref. 26729). Considered as endangered (Lozano and Contreras, 1989) and species of special concern (Williams et al., 1989) (Ref. 26729). Also Ref. 12255, 27139.

Status of threat: extirpated in nature. Criteria: 1,5 (http://fisc.er.usgs.gov/afs/) (Ref. 81264).
